Porto Seguro FAQ

What is Porto Seguro known for?

Porto Seguro is known for its beautiful beaches, lively nightlife, and historical significance as the site of Brazil's first landing by Portuguese explorers.

What is the best time of year to visit Porto Seguro?

The best time to visit Porto Seguro is during the dry season from May to October, when there is less rain and temperatures are cooler. However, this is also the peak tourist season, so expect crowded beaches and higher prices.

Can I fly directly to Porto Seguro?

Yes, there are direct flights to Porto Seguro from major Brazilian cities and some international destinations.

What are some popular attractions in Porto Seguro?

Some popular attractions in Porto Seguro include the historical center, the Passarela do Álcool (alcohol alley) with its bars and restaurants, the beaches of Taperapuã and Mutá, and the nearby Recife de Fora Marine Park.

What is the currency used in Porto Seguro?

The currency used in Porto Seguro is the Brazilian real (BRL). ATMs and currency exchange offices are widely available.

Travel Guide to Porto Seguro

Located in the state of Bahia, Porto Seguro is a popular destination for tourists looking for a relaxing vacation in Brazil. Here’s a travel guide to help you make the most out of your trip to Porto Seguro:1. Historic Downtown: Start your trip by exploring the charming historic downtown of Porto Seguro. This area is known for its colorful colonial buildings, cobbled streets, and beautiful churches. Some of the must-visit landmarks include the Museu de Porto Seguro, the Cidade Histórica, and the São Benedito church.2. Beaches: Porto Seguro boasts some of the most beautiful beaches in Brazil. The most popular beaches include Praia de Taperapuan, Praia do Mutá, and Praia do Espelho. These beaches have crystal-clear waters, soft sand, and are great for swimming, sunbathing, and water sports.3. Nightlife: Porto Seguro has a vibrant nightlife scene with a variety of bars, clubs, and music venues. If you’re looking for a party, head to Passarela do Álcool, where you’ll find an array of bars and street vendors selling traditional Brazilian food and drinks.4. Adventure: For the adventurous traveler, Porto Seguro has plenty of activities to offer. You can go zip-lining, trekking, or take a quad bike tour through the lush jungles of the surrounding area.5. Food: Brazilian cuisine is rich and flavorful, and Porto Seguro is no exception. You can find traditional dishes such as feijoada and moqueca, as well as seafood platters and tropical fruit juices.6. Culture: The Bahian culture is deeply rooted in religion, music, and dance. If you have a chance, attend a local festival or a Capoeira show to get a taste of the culture.7. Memorial da Epopeia do Descobrimento: This museum offers a unique perspective on the discovery of Brazil by the Portuguese sailors. The museum showcases artifacts and provides a timeline of the events leading to the discovery of the country.Porto Seguro is a great destination for those looking for a mix of relaxation, adventure, and culture. With its beautiful beaches, vibrant nightlife, and rich history, there’s something for everyone in this charming Brazilian town.
